Output ecb6cc111b085c76d2475c4ba61d5a51ea79b71da41a17c0e5a0ffd21a8749ec:1

value
35630553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54cb6bbed4fa4167441c8b40d148ccdd4541f2ea OP_EQUAL
address
39RNNb4Yr92VJwm4naFdhbCDd8R53B4i2s
transaction
ecb6cc111b085c76d2475c4ba61d5a51ea79b71da41a17c0e5a0ffd21a8749ec
spent
true